Title :
Influence of Personality Traits on the Rational Process of Cognitive Agents

Abstract :
In this paper we present an approach based on the principle that psychological capacities, especially personality traits, influence the decision making process of rational agents. While using the FFM/NEO PI-R taxonomy, we propose a model for the expression of personality traits in terms of so-called influence operators that add meta control rules to the cycle of rational BDI agents.
